Reconnect! Witch Water Workshop - 21st February 11am - 1pm

⋆˖⁺‧₊☽◯☾₊‧⁺˖⋆

Each of these Reconnect workshops will include meditation or grounding, an element of storytelling and sharing in circle, curiosity and creative practices. We will encourage you to reflect on your own needs and practices, and focus on collective sensory and artistic experiences. It will be a space to explore, experience, and discuss what it means to practice or explore magic and art in today’s world. We look forward to learning from each other in this space!

This is an intergenerational space and children are welcome if accompanied by a responsible adult.

Water and Tea

This workshop will begin with a mindful practice of drinking tea or herbal tisanes and sharing stories about their meaning. We will learn a bit about the history and practice of reading tea leaves, tasseography.  There are many different approaches, and you will have the chance to explore and create your own intuitive method as we read each other’s leaves. You will also get to make some bespoke tea to take home with you in a nifty tea ball.
